First of all, I’d like to introduce you to the new structure you can explore, the “Trial Chamber.” This structure spawns randomly below the surface of the overworld, between Y:-20 and Y:-40 and is relatively easy to find. These are mostly located under large bodies of water like lakes or the ocean.
Entering this set of chambers, you’ll encounter new copper and tuff blocks forming rooms that you can explore and collect all the resources within them. But be careful, as it won’t be easy; in these chambers, you’ll face fierce enemies that want to end your adventure.
Around the chambers, you’ll find the new “trial spawner,” which spawns mobs depending on the number of players around. These creatures will come in waves and once you defeat all the spawners will be rewarded with some loot. Here you can encounter any type of hostile creature, including the new mob Bogged. Stay alert because among all the enemies, you’ll find the other new mob Breeze, looking like a small tornado with a head. Breeze will attack you with wind gusts pushing you into the air.
If these challenges seem too easy, you can increase the difficulty by performing an “Ominous Event” which can be activated by entering the trial chamber with the “bad omen” effect. Before entering the chamber, you’ll need to drink the potion to activate it. This will make all the trial spawners change, now they will generate mobs every 8 seconds. and will have a chance to spawn with armor. This new spawner also will produce 2 projectiles, one with a lingering effect randomly selected over de 7 in existence and the other can be one of the following: Poison arrow, slowarrow, fire charge wind charge, bottle o´enchanting. Once you overcome this new difficulty, the loot will be greater and much more valuable.
Now that you know how it works it’s time to talk about the rewards you can find inside these chambers after you defeat all the enemies. Scattered around, you’ll find chests and jars. The highest value rewards are found in the new trial spawners and vaults, these last are accessible only with the trial key found only inside the trial chamber mainly in the trial spawners. In these vaults, you can find the highest rewards ranging from enchantments, enchanted weapons, diamond armor, or even loose diamonds! For all collectors, inside these chambers, you’ll find exclusive loot. These include new design patterns (two of them) that you can place on armor, banners, and jars. Additionally, you can find the three new music discs added to Minecraft’s soundtrack. If this loot looks too poor, remember that by doing the ominous trial you will receive much better loot. This loot can range from enchantments, blocks of iron, emerald or even diamonds to exclusive items like music discs and the new heavy core, needed for the new weapon the mace.
In this update, you’ll find some new mobs added to the Minecraft world. We’ll introduce each of the new creatures you can find in the new “Tricky Trials update.”
The Bogged is a kind of skeleton that spawns in any kind of swamp biome. They look like they are covered with some kind of moss and always have mushrooms growing in their heads. This new type of skeleton has the ability of poisoning you for 4 seconds with their projectiles. So be careful the next time you explore the swamps at night.
Appearing only in the trial chamber, Breeze mobs spawn from trial spawners. This little tornado is a feisty enemy. Although it doesn’t deal much damage per hit, it is quite difficult to eliminate since projectiles don’t affect it and its attack sends you flying into the air. After elimination, they only dropped Breeze Rod. You can use these little sticks to make wind charge, the new mace and the new Flow Armor Trim Smithing Template.
Another interesting change brought by the 1.21 update is the improvement in how portals work. Both in the Nether and the End, portals have undergone some changes.
Now, you can cross the portal on any means of transport, both as a player and with other entities like the “chicken jockey”. That means you can now cross to the Nether with your horse or your donkey. Also you can connect the overworld with the Nether by train rails and travel through it without problems.
Another feature is that from now on, ender pearls will cross the portal and continue flying through the Nether! The direction you throw them in also matters, as they will keep flying in that direction and will only teleport you when they hit a block on the other side. So be careful and be ready for your next adventure.
Similar to the Nether changes, now you can travel to the End using ender pearls. In this case though, when you enter the End you will always appear in the center of the obsidian platform. Speaking of that, now the obsidian platform regenerates all of the blocks you may break.

You can now attach ropes to boats, allowing you to pull and drag them behind you. This opens up endless possibilities for transporting items and mobs, like villagers or pets, regardless of whether they are on land or sea.
As we saw earlier, this update introduces several new blocks, both for construction and utility. For construction, we can find new designs that you can create with copper and tuff. These naturally appear inside the trial chamber, forming its walls and floors. Now you will be able to craft more than 50 new blocks, between various colors of copper blocks and the new tuff blocks. Now you can craft automatically with the new table “the crafter”. This allows you to select a recipe and let the block handle the crafting. You just need to supply the necessary resources for this small table to create endless items quickly and efficiently. This automatic crafter needs to be impulsed by redstone. It may seem like a small thing at first glance, but for all lovers of construction and engineering within Minecraft, it revolutionizes how they create resource farms.
The mace is the new weapon added to the Minecraft world. It works like any other melee weapon in the game but the mace increases its damage if you fall on the enemy from a height of more than two blocks. This weapon is easy to craft but difficult to obtain its materials –You will need a breeze Rod and a heavy core. The breeze rod is easy to find because the breeze drops it always you defeat it. The heavy core on the other hand, has a chance of only 7.5% to appear as a loot of the Ominous vault in the trial chamber. Making the mace a late game object.
